Splet12. dec. 2024 · Follow these guidelines to prevent aspiration when you’re eating and drinking by mouth: Avoid distractions when you’re eating and drinking, such as talking on … SpletThe trach tube is kept in place with ties made from cloth or Velcro which go around the neck, like a necklace. The wings of the trach have slits to hold these ties. Speech with a Tracheostomy When a trach is in place, air goes in and out of the lungs below the voice box. In many cases air can flow out through the vocal cords and out the trach tube. SpletThese exercises will help you breathe better and improve the function of your lungs. The incentive spirometer gives you a way to take an active part in your recovery. Because you have a tracheostomy (trach) tube, your incentive spirometer has a 1-way valve called a T-piece instead of a mouthpiece. http://www.ksha.org/docs/SLP24_Assessment_and_Treatment_of_Dysphagia.pdf Splet02. apr. 2024 · Trach ties go around your neck and help keep the trach tube in place. A cuff fills with air and helps hold the tube in your airway. You may see a thin tube hanging from the outer cannula. Air can be inserted or removed from the cuff through this tube. Your trach may not have a cuff.

Splet12. dec. 2024 · These exercises will help prevent changes in your ability to swallow during your radiation therapy. They’ll also help you keep your ability to swallow over time. Your swallowing specialist will tell you when to start doing them. The exercises won’t be helpful if you start them too soon after surgery or too far before your radiation therapy.
